British pharmaceutical firm
AMCo has purchased locally-based
Boucher and Muir, which sells
medical products across Australia,
New Zealand and in the Pacific.
Boucher & Muir has been working
together with AMCo for the past
ten years, with AMCo saying
the move will allow it to create
a regional commercial centre in
Australia.
“Boucher and Muir has been our
trusted partner in the Australasian
region for the past decade,” said
John Beighton, AMCo ceo.
“It has a strong history of
supplying niche medicines in the
region and we will be looking to
build on that as a cornerstone of
